刘子华等:偶极子横波测并方法的实验研究,测井技术,1996(3)20,157~161。最近,研制出两种新的偶极子声源,一种是片状的,另一种是圆管状的。对两种声源的性能进行了实验比较,发现室内混凝土模型井中观测到的偶极子声波(弯曲波)波形的首波相速度近似等于混凝土横波速度,其视频率约为单极子声波频率的一半,即10kHZ左右。实验还表明,在短源距时测定弯曲波参数较为方便。
Liu et al .: Experimental study of the dipole transverse shear measurement method, Logging Technology, 1996 (3) 20, 157 ~ 161. Recently, two new dipole sources have been developed, one of which is sheet-like and the other of which is cylindrical in shape. The experimental comparison of the performance of the two sound sources shows that the first phase velocity of the dipole acoustic wave (bending wave) waveform observed in the indoor concrete model well is approximately equal to the shear wave velocity of concrete, and the video frequency is about the monopole acoustic frequency Half, that is about 10kHZ. Experiments also show that it is more convenient to measure bending wave parameters at short source distance.
